About the Author
Robert A. Yelle is professor of the theory and method of religious studies at Ludwig Maximilian University, Munich. He is the author of Explaining Mantras: Ritual, Rhetoric, and the Dream of a Natural Language in Hindu Tantra; The Language of Disenchantment: Protestant Literalism and Colonial Discourse in British India; and Semiotics of Religion: Signs of the Sacred in History.
